Enhancing the physical properties of water-borne dispersion polymers, such as polyurethane and acrylic latexes, CoatOSil™ 2287 silane enables the formulation of coatings with good shelf stability, improved wet adhesion and enhanced resistance to water and organic solvents. This non-yellowing additive can be considered as an adhesion promoter or crosslinker.

CoatOSil 2287 silane is an excellent candidate to consider for formulations employing carboxylated latexes (acrylic, SBR, polyurethane, etc.) exhibiting a pH between 6 and 8.5. CoatOSil 2287 silane may be employed as an adhesion promoter or crosslinker. It may be suitable for use as a water stable single component crosslinker in applications such as:

  • Wood furniture and flooring finishes
  • Metal coatings

In such applications, CoatOSil 2287 silane may provide a means of replacing a 2 part waterborne coating with a single component system. The potential benefits of a silane crosslinked water stable single component system include reduced scrap, improved process efficiency and reduced crosslinker toxicity.
